Stage 1–3: Research, Briefing, and Drafting

  1. Signal detection. The system monitors search engines and AI models for buyer questions where competitors are recommended or where new intent clusters emerge. Instead of quarterly keyword hunts, the team receives a living queue of validated opportunities.
  2. Automated brief generation. The platform clusters keywords by intent, analyzes SERP composition, and produces a structured brief with recommended headings, related questions, and competitor gaps.
  3. Hybrid drafting. AI assembles a first draft from the brief, injected with proprietary data points, named sources, and specific examples. A subject-matter expert then edits for perspective and tone.

The research stage is where the largest time savings occur. Brief generation that once took an hour now takes minutes. That compression allows strategists to focus on validation rather than excavation.

Stage 4–6: QA, Publishing, and Continuous Optimization

  1. Automated QA. Before any page goes live, checks run for factual consistency, tone deviation, broken schema, missing alt text, and internal link opportunities.
  2. Programmatic publishing. The approved draft flows directly into the CMS with metadata, URL structure, and markup pre-populated. No copy-pasting. No formatting drift.
  3. Performance-driven refresh. After publication, the system tracks rankings, click-through rates, and AI citation signals. Pages that stall or decay automatically enter a refresh queue.

Teams that adopt this lifecycle typically replace the traditional editorial calendar with a product backlog. Articles have owners, versions, and acceptance criteria. The result is not more noise. Intent Clustering and Competitor Gap Analysis

The best automated research does not merely dump keywords into a bucket. It compares your current rankings against competitor coverage, then scores opportunities by relevance, difficulty, and search volume. This gap analysis prevents the common mistake of writing the hundredth article on a saturated definition when an adjacent comparison query has half the competition and twice the purchase intent.

In practice, a SaaS company selling project management software might discover that competitors own "what is project management software" but ignore "project management software for construction billing." The brief then targets the latter, with headings that reflect the specific integration and compliance concerns of that vertical. The result is a page that speaks to a defined buyer, not a generic reader.

Injecting Original Angles Before the Draft

The greatest danger of automation is consensus. AI trained on average web content produces average web content. Bernard Huang, founder of Clearscope, emphasizes the concept of Information Gain: AI tools re-hash average web consensus. To rank, non-manual content must incorporate proprietary data, unique insights, or expert commentary to avoid being filtered out by Google’s redundancy updates.

The brief is the last place to inject this value. Before any draft begins, the strategist should add a first-party statistic, a customer quote, a product screenshot, or a contrarian take. Without this step, even the most sophisticated pipeline produces commodity pages. Google’s helpful content systems reward real-world grounding and clear authorial perspective. Automation that skips the angle injection step fails twice: it bores the reader and it signals to search classifiers that the page is derivative.

Programmatic SEO and Templated Pages: When They Work, When They Fail

Programmatic SEO works when structured data maps to genuine user questions across hundreds of variations, but it fails when templates spawn thin pages without unique value. In 2026, the winners launch small batches, validate indexation and engagement, then scale. They avoid publishing thousands of pages on day one.

A software engineer and content lead inspecting a spreadsheet of page templates and data variables before approving a batch publish Programmatic pages succeed when data and editorial judgment are checked in tandem.

ChatGPT and Gemini both list programmatic SEO as a primary alternative, yet they understate the indexation risk. Google's classifier can detect mass-produced templated pages within days. If the dynamic content does not vary meaningfully from one URL to the next, the site invites a helpful content penalty. The old advice of launching 5,000 pages from a spreadsheet is now a liability. Crawl budget is finite, and search engines will simply stop indexing thin variations.

Validated Patterns That Scale

The patterns that still work in 2026 follow a rigid rule: every page must answer a distinct question with distinct data. Common valid patterns include:

  • /alternatives/{competitor} pages with unique positioning matrices
  • /best/{software-category}-for-{industry} pages with tailored feature comparisons
  • /integrations/{tool}/{platform} pages with setup-specific screenshots or steps
  • Location or role-based landing pages with localized context beyond mere name insertion

Indexation Traps and Staggered Rollouts

38% of marketers use AI to create content briefs and outlines, and that same systematic mindset must apply to programmatic launch velocity. We recommend a staggered rollout:

  1. Publish an initial batch of 50 to 100 pages.
  2. Monitor indexation rate and click-through rate for four to six weeks.
  3. Validate that early pages earn impressions without triggering coverage warnings.
  4. Scale the template only after the data proves reader value.

Practical rule: Launch no more than 100 programmatic pages in a batch. Wait four to six weeks, validate indexation and click-through rates, then scale. Mass publishing on day one is the fastest path to a helpful-content penalty.

Governance and Quality Assurance: The Hidden Layer

Governance is the difference between a content engine and a content factory. In 2026, scalable teams run every automated draft through a three-stage checkpoint: factual accuracy, tone alignment, and E-E-A-T injection. Without this layer, AI output drifts toward consensus, dated examples, and vague claims that neither Google nor AI engines cite.

Competitor roundups rarely discuss governance because it is not a feature checkbox. It is an operational discipline. AI can generate a draft in seconds, but it cannot verify whether a cited statistic is from 2023 or 2026. It cannot know that your brand avoids aggressive superlatives. It cannot interview a customer for a quote. These are human functions, and they scale only through clear protocols.

The Three-Stage Editorial Checkpoint

Before any page moves from draft to publish, it should pass these three gates:

  1. Fact check. Verify every statistic, name, date, and product claim. AI hallucinates sources and invents studies. If a claim cannot be traced to a primary source, it must be cut or rewritten.
  2. Tone alignment. Confirm that vocabulary, sentence length, and point of view match the brand’s documented voice. This is especially critical for sections generated from templates.
  3. E-E-A-T injection. Add demonstrable experience: a first-party metric, a customer result, a product screenshot, or an expert quote. Google’s systems explicitly reward content that shows real-world grounding and original analysis.

Schema, Linking, and Technical Hygiene at Scale

Automation must extend to the page surround, not just the body copy. In 2026, every article needs parseable structure to rank and to be cited. That means FAQ schema on definitional pages, breadcrumb logic, internal link insertion based on entity relationships, and IndexNow pings for rapid discovery.

The Economics of Refresh vs. New Production

For established sites, refreshing existing content often delivers faster ROI than publishing new articles. Pages that already have backlinks and age can regain positions with targeted updates. The hybrid lifecycle automates this detection: when a page drops three or more positions, or a competitor overtakes it, the system flags the article for revision.

Marketing teams that treat refresh as maintenance rather than growth usually miscalculate. A refreshed page that reclaims a top-three position can outperform three new pages in the same timeframe.
